The Postgraduate Certificate in Microelectronic Engineering is a specialized program designed for individuals seeking advanced knowledge in the field of microelectronic engineering.
This program is ideal for those who have a bachelor's degree in a relevant field and wish to enhance their skills in microelectronic engineering, a rapidly growing area of technology.
The learning outcomes of this program include gaining a deeper understanding of microelectronic engineering principles, designing and developing microelectronic systems, and applying microelectronic engineering techniques to real-world problems.
The duration of the program typically ranges from 6 to 12 months, depending on the institution and the student's prior experience.
The program is designed to equip students with the knowledge and skills required to work in the microelectronic industry, which is a significant sector in the global electronics market.
The industry relevance of this program is high, as microelectronic engineering is a critical component of modern technology, including smartphones, computers, and other electronic devices.
Graduates of this program can pursue careers in research and development, design engineering, and manufacturing, or work as consultants and engineers in various industries.
The program is also relevant to those interested in pursuing a Ph.D. in microelectronic engineering or a related field, as it provides a solid foundation for advanced research and studies.
